Global Operations Risk Control & Security Operations Lead - TikTok Shop - EMEA **Location**: London Employment Type: Regular Job Code: A51836A **Responsibilities**: About the Team The TikTok E-commerce Governance and Experience team ensures our marketplace remains safe, trustworthy, and customer-centric across the globe. We protect users, sellers, and creators by designing policies, building systems, and managing operations that safeguard platform integrity. We are seeking a Risk Control & Security Operations Lead to oversee our risk management and fraud prevention operations in the EMEA region. Beyond managing investigations and escalations, this role plays a critical part in partnering with regional business teams to balance growth with trust and safety. You will bridge business objectives and risk control goals — ensuring solutions are pragmatic, scalable, and aligned with both user trust and commercial priorities. **Responsibilities**: 1. Lead and scale fraud/risk operations in EMEA, including detection, investigation, and mitigation of abuse. 2. Serve as the primary business partner to regional commercial and operations teams: understand their needs, identify potential risks, and co-develop solutions that enable safe growth. 3. Collaborate with Risk Strategy PMs and Risk Analytics teams to co-design and refine risk control strategies for the region. 4. Partner with Product, Data Science, and Policy teams to close system gaps, improve models, and design preventive workflows. 5. Monitor and report regional risk trends, highlight emerging threats, and proactively propose mitigations. 6. Oversee regulatory and law enforcement requests, ensuring compliance and accurate, timely submissions. 7. Act as the senior escalation point for high-impact fraud incidents, appeals, and disputes. 8. Build team capability by coaching specialists, setting clear KPIs, and fostering collaboration across global and regional teams. 9. Drive continuous improvement and automation to increase efficiency, resilience, and scalability of risk operations. **Qualifications**: Minimum Qualification(s) 1.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ience in Risk Management, Cybersecurity, Business, Law, or Data Analytics. 2. 5+ years in fraud operations, risk control, trust & safety, or related fields, with at least 2 years in a leadership capacity. 3. Proven success in balancing business enablement with risk control, and influencing senior business stakeholders. 4. Strong analytical and investigative mindset; experience working with risk models, data-driven insights, and strategy teams is highly valued. 5. Experience engaging with regulators or law enforcement. 6. Exceptional stakeholder management and communication skills; able to build trust across both business and technical teams. Preferred Qualification(s) 1. Familiarity with SQL, Python, or equivalent tools is a plus. 2.
